If you want to publish your Excel workbook on a web-site or blog, perform these 3 quick steps in the Excel web app: With the workbook open in Excel Online, click Share Embed, and then click the Generate button.
Add a Sheet View Select the worksheet where you want the Sheet View, then click to View Sheet View New. Apply the sort/filter that you want. Excel automatically names your new view Temporary View to indicate the Sheet View isnt saved yet.
Submit a HTML form to Google Sheets Set up a Google Sheet. Go to Google Sheets and create a new sheet. Create a Google App Script. Click on Extensions - Apps Script . Run the initialSetup function. You should see a modal asking for permissions. Add a trigger for the script. Publish the project. Configure your HTML form.
Publish the workbook Click the File tab, and then click Save Send. Click Save to SharePoint. If you want to select individual worksheets or items to publish in the workbook, click the Publish Options button. Choose a location in which to publish your workbook.
Start by opening the desired Excel spreadsheets in Microsoft Office Excel. Open the File. Click Save As. At the bottom of the window, click on the down arrow of the drop-down menu. Select Web Page from the list. In the File Name box, type an appropriate name for the file. Click Publish.
If you want to display a Google doc on a web page, you can use the built-in Publish to web function from the Google Docs File menu. This turns your doc into an automatically updating web page that is publicly available.
Share a workbook in Excel for the web Select File Share Share with People (or select Share in the top right). In the Enter a name or email address box, type the email addresses of people you want to share with.
